Transaction 31e34c42fc938bea07613997deeae1bae6ae12ef298a712ca8d05fbcbcc92d7a

11 Input
2 Outputs
  • 31e34c42fc938bea07613997deeae1bae6ae12ef298a712ca8d05fbcbcc92d7a:0
  • value  6907553
    address  3Lxxqpj6HfsjX9KMxmgFJF8H6rdReXbXnS
  • 31e34c42fc938bea07613997deeae1bae6ae12ef298a712ca8d05fbcbcc92d7a:1
  • value  863560
    address  3Paboa6UeCDWvn35HDDe5YNfm5gttduM1a